Rory McIlroy Frustrated as Weather Suspends PGA Championship Play at Quail Hollow

Play Halted Amid Storm Warnings
Round 3 of the 2025 PGA Championship was brought to a sudden standstill on Saturday morning after play was suspended at 8:15 AM due to hazardous weather in the Charlotte area. The PGA Tour issued an urgent shelter advisory for fans and players alike, with updates pending based on evolving conditions.

McIlroy’s Raw Reaction Caught on Camera
Rory McIlroy, clearly caught off-guard and irritated by the delay, was overheard muttering “F—k off” in response to the suspension announcement. The Northern Irishman was in rhythm at the time, and his reaction underscores the mounting tension players are feeling as weather continues to disrupt the major.

A Frustrating Pattern at Quail Hollow
This isn’t the first hiccup at Quail Hollow this week. Players have already voiced their displeasure over inconsistent conditions, ranging from mud balls affecting play to criticisms of ESPN’s tournament coverage. Now, weather delays add another layer of disruption to an already tense championship.

Title Hopes in Limbo
McIlroy, who remains in the hunt for his fifth major title, is one of several top contenders now forced to recalibrate and wait. For golfers like Rory—momentum-driven and mentally locked in—a sudden stop can be more than a nuisance; it can be game-changing.
